Warren Davidson discusses US foreign policy and stablecoins

Warren Davidson, a U.S. Congressman representing Ohio's 8th district since 2016, recently shared several thoughts on international relations and financial matters through social media. Davidson succeeded John Boehner in this congressional seat and has been active in various discussions pertinent to national interests.

On June 18, 2025, Davidson expressed his views on the United States' involvement in foreign conflicts. He stated that "No ally should assume the United States will finish their war... Nevertheless, we help our friends and seek peace where it can be won. Still, not our war." This comment reflects a cautious approach to international military engagements while underscoring support for allies.

Later that same day, Davidson invited followers to watch an interview with Matt Gaetz discussing Iran's geopolitical strategies and America's role in global affairs. He wrote, "Watch my interview with @mattgaetz tonight! Iran's miscalculation and America's role..." The discussion aimed at shedding light on pressing international issues involving Iran.

In the early hours of June 19, 2025, Davidson addressed economic topics by questioning the reluctance to define a commodity-backed stablecoin. He commented: "No wonder they don’t want to define a commodity (gold) backed stablecoin…" This statement suggests skepticism towards the regulatory environment surrounding digital currencies.

Warren Davidson was born in Sidney, Ohio in 1970 and currently resides in Troy. Before joining Congress, he served on the Concord Township Board of Trustees from 2004 to 2005.
